Spotlock is Hiring a Registered Architect Near Staten Island, NY

About Us:

We are a reputable full-service architectural and engineering firm with over 30 years of experience in the metropolitan area. Our firm boasts an extensive portfolio of over 7,000 projects, ranging from small home alterations to multi-story buildings and major shopping centers. We offer a comprehensive range of professional services, including site engineering, architectural design, structural engineering, HVAC design, and fire suppression system design. Our commitment to excellence and client satisfaction has been the cornerstone of our success.

Job Description:

As a Registered Architect working out of our Staten Island, NY office, you will play a pivotal role in the design and execution of architectural projects across various sectors, including residential, commercial, industrial, and institutional. You will collaborate closely with our multidisciplinary team of engineers and designers to deliver innovative and functional solutions that meet the needs of our clients.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ead the architectural design process from concept development to construction documentation and administration.
  • Develop creative and practical design solutions that align with client requirements, budget constraints, and regulatory standards.
  • Produce accurate drawings, specifications, and renderings using CAD software (AutoCAD, Revit, etc.).
  • Conduct site visits and surveys to assess existing conditions and gather relevant information for project planning.
  • Coordinate with internal teams and external consultants to integrate structural, mechanical, and electrical systems into the architectural design.
  • Review and approve contractor submittals, shop drawings, and material samples to ensure compliance with design intent and specifications.
  • Provide technical expertise and guidance to junior staff members, interns, and drafters.
  • Communicate effectively with clients, contractors, and regulatory authorities to address project-related issues and ensure timely project delivery.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Architecture from an accredited institution.
  • Registered Architect (RA) license in the state of New York.
  • Familiarity with New York City Department of Buildings required.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in architectural design and project management.
  • Proficiency in CAD software (AutoCAD, Revit) and Adobe Creative Suite.
  • Strong understanding of building codes, zoning regulations, and construction practices.
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and leadership skills.
  • Ability to work effectively in a collaborative team environment and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Experience with sustainable design principles and LEED accreditation (preferred).

Benefits:

  • Competitive salary commensurate with experience.
  • Comprehensive benefits package including health insurance, retirement plans, and paid time off.
  • Professional development opportunities and support for continuing education.
  • Dynamic and inclusive work environment with opportunities for career advancement.
